Pantothenic Acid/Yeast Polypeptide
What Pantothenic Acid/Yeast Polypeptide is & what it does
Pantothenic Acid is vitamin B5, a water-soluble vitamin used in skincare formulas, often as its more stable derivative panthenol. In topical products it functions as a humectant and skin-conditioning agent, helping the skin surface feel soft and hydrated. It is a common, well-tolerated ingredient in moisturizers and after-sun or sunscreen lotions.
